The contract drafter should include separate lines for initials or signatures by the parties to the waiver, indicating their acknowledgment of the Civil Code section 1542 waiver, along with a statement that the releasing parties are aware of the meaning of the statute and intend, by signing the release, to waive and relinquish any and all rights and benefits which they may have under the statute and to assume the risk of any then-existing but as yet unknown claims. Thus, it is possible to obtain an enforceable release of unknown claims notwithstanding section 1542 - but broad release language itself won't do the trick. California Civil Code section 1542 is a statutory protection for parties who sign a settlement agreement containing a general release of claims. California Civil Code 1542 reads as follows: A GENERAL RELEASE DOES NOT EXTEND TO CLAIMS THAT THE CREDITOR OR RELEASING PARTY DOES NOT KNOW OR SUSPECT TO EXIST IN HIS OR HER FAVOR AT THE TIME OF EXECUTING THE RELEASE AND THAT, IF KNOWN BY HIM OR HER, WOULD HAVE MATERIALLY AFFECTED HIS OR HER SETTLEMENT WITH THE DEBTOR OR RELEASED PARTY.
